  • What is EPS Sandwich Panel?

    EPS (Expanded Polystyrene) Sandwich Panel is a lightweight, cost-effective building material composed of two outer layers of durable steel sheets and a core of EPS foam. The EPS core provides excellent thermal insulation, while the steel surfaces offer structural strength and protection. This combination makes EPS sandwich panels ideal for use in prefab house wall systems, offering quick installation and efficient performance.

  • Properties of EPS Sandwich Panels

    Thermal Insulation

    The EPS core significantly reduces heat transfer, helping maintain indoor temperature and improve energy efficiency in prefab buildings.

    Lightweight & Easy Installation

    EPS panels are light in weight, reducing structural load and allowing for quick, easy installation on-site, saving time and labor.

    Cost-Effective

    Compared to other insulated panels, EPS sandwich panels offer an economical solution without sacrificing essential performance.

    Moisture Resistance

    EPS foam is resistant to moisture absorption, reducing the risk of mold and maintaining panel integrity over time.

    Good Acoustic Performance

    While not as sound-absorbing as mineral wool, EPS panels still provide a reasonable level of noise reduction in residential and light commercial settings.

    Fire Performance

    Standard EPS is combustible, but panels can be upgraded with fire-retardant additives or protective facings to improve fire behavior depending on project needs.

  • Common Specifications

    EPS Sandwich panels are often customized to meet specific needs, but some common specifications include:

    Thickness

    Common core thicknesses include 50 mm, 75 mm, and 100 mm, with custom thicknesses available on request.

    Panel Width

    Standard effective width is 950 mm or 1150 mm, depending on design.

    Panel Length

    Custom lengths are available, typically ranging from 1.8 m to 12 m, depending on transportation and installation requirements.

    Steel Sheet

    Pre-painted galvanized steel (PPGI) or aluminum-zinc coated steel is used for outer layers, typically 0.4 mm – 0.6 mm thick.

    Core Density

    Standard EPS core density is around 12 – 20 kg/m³.

    Surface Finish

    Flat or corrugated surface options, available in various colors and coatings for aesthetic and durability preferences

  • Applications

    EPS Sandwich Panels are commonly used in:

    • Exterior and Interior Walls
      Providing thermal insulation and structural support in residential, commercial, and industrial prefab buildings.
    • Partition Walls
      Lightweight and easy to install, ideal for internal dividing walls in modular units or office cabins.
    • Cold Storage & Temporary Buildings
      EPS panels are often used in low-cost cold rooms and temporary housing due to their insulation and affordability.
    • Roof Panels (with proper slope)
      In certain designs, EPS sandwich panels can also be used for roofing with appropriate slope and sealing.
  • Conclusion

    EPS Sandwich Panels offer a practical, lightweight, and economical solution for prefab house wall systems. With good thermal insulation, ease of installation, and customization options, they are a popular choice in a wide range of modular and prefabricated construction projects.
